Output ddba110d77946d82c5db0a5f1bc3dd920ee2b23bbbf63f0edfbf7076ded2c04f:0

value
36000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ad27d931f17ecf3d91b07f74dcb0253fd0626ebb OP_EQUAL
address
3HUaZStAXGzghTJzSGhrmCvsoRBXE7iVMk
transaction
ddba110d77946d82c5db0a5f1bc3dd920ee2b23bbbf63f0edfbf7076ded2c04f
confirmations
292653
spent
true